Easter Labyrinth
The Labyrinth goes back to Greek mythology and was apparently built to house a “beast” so it couldn’t get out! However, it has frequently been used as a Spiritual practice and aid to meditation. This is the purpose of our Labyrinth during Easter week. Some have been grown as part of a garden, but many simpler ones, like ours, are used indoors. Good Friday Service
This is not a day for mourning, but for awe. wonder. love and gratitude. On Good Friday we come to hear the story of Jesus and his sacrifice on the Cross.But Good Friday and Easter Sunday are inextricably linked. As we remember the events of Good Friday, we look forward to the completion of the story on Easter Sunday.
Easter Sunday
On Easter Sunday, the church celebrates the resurrection of Christ, however and whatever we understand this to be. At Easter Christ invites us into new life with him. Easter can be a new beginning for us all. Come and celebrate.
